!!!2008-present : BAYSTOW This project aims at developing efficient algorithms for stowing containers into vessel bays. These problems are characterized by 1) being under constrained, since containers assigned to a bay already fulfil global constraints and objectives, 2) being highly symmetric, since a bay may contain many container stacks with identical properties, and 3) having a large number of combinatorial side constraint due to business specific stacking rules. We seek to achieve fundamental understanding of the structure of this problem by comparing a wide range of exact and approximate optimization approaches including local search, integer prgramming, constraint programming, and column generation. The research project is carried out in collaboration with [[http://www.maersk.com/en/Frontpage.htm | A.P. Møller - Mærsk]] and [[http://www.ange | Ange Optimization]].
